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90687411 6189 707669
8512721435 00076
8512721435 00076
83709543777 048744819 81124645 018
All about undefined
Interested in learning more?
8512721435 00076
83709543777 048744819 81124645 018
See more
8113 89
71427 83128948161 5201
See more
1892 9076862203 855
70971 22343 32294726884
See more